Integrating Therapeutic Approaches with Online Care

Dr. Harriet Heath draws on several evidence-informed approaches to meet different needs.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on how early relationships shape current patterns - it helps people understand emotional bonds and improve how they relate to others.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es listening and collaboration - the therapist follows the client's lead, offering empathy and support to promote self-awareness and personal growth.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, helps people identify and shift unhelpful thoughts and behaviors - it is often used for anxiety, depression, and stress-related concerns.
